Steve C left this review about Woodworkers
Woodworkers seems to be the crafty side of Laverys next door and there’s an interconnecting door in the left wall. The interior is J-shaped with seating up some steps down the longer right hand side. A couple of screens hanging from the ceiling were listing 14 craft keg beers which ranged from How Wonderful Cloudwater Brew, 3.7%, £5.70 a pint to Parade Beak New England IPA, 6%, £9.00 a pint. The food menu is the same as next door, the burger is priced at £14, and the double is £17.50 which is top end for any pub I visited during my stay in Belfast. It was comfortable in here during my midweek evening visit, but I imagine it gets a bit hectic at the weekend. This area seems to be the late night part of Belfast so I’ll probably not venture down here again now that I’ve been.
